相关文章推荐
失落的勺子  ·  Exploring the ...·  1 年前    · 
面冷心慈的红酒  ·  WPF - Adorner - ...·  1 年前    · 
痴情的上铺  ·  SQLite ...·  1 年前    · 

jsdoc return object type

在 JSDoc 中,如果需要指定一个函数返回值的类型为对象,可以使用以下语法:

* @returns { Object } function myFunction ( ) { return { foo : 'bar' };

在这个例子中,我们使用 @returns 标记来指定该函数的返回值类型。在 {} 内,我们指定了该类型为 Object 。当这个函数被调用时,它将返回一个包含 foo 属性的对象。

需要注意的是,在 JavaScript 中,对象是一种动态类型,因此不同的对象可能包含不同的属性。如果你希望进一步指定返回对象的属性和属性类型,可以在 {} 内使用 property 标记,如下所示:

* @returns { {foo: string, bar: number }} function myFunction ( ) { return { foo : 'hello' , bar : 42 };

在这个例子中,我们使用了 @returns 标记来指定该函数的返回值类型为一个对象。在 {} 内,我们指定了该对象包含两个属性: foo bar foo 的类型为字符串, bar 的类型为数字。

希望这些信息能帮到你。如果你还有其他问题,请随时继续提问。

  •